[23:46:12] enyc: tgm4883, superm1: OK I have build failures.... it loooks like this ''testing'' for building with php5 or php7.0 fails so you don't get mythweb/etc and soforth
[23:46:25] enyc: tgm4883, superm1: http://anna.enyc.org.uk:8080/xenial-amd64/hom . . . uild-log.txt
[23:46:47] natanojl (natanojl!~jonatan@mythtv/developer/natanojl) has quit (Ping timeout: 260 seconds)
[23:47:36] tgm4883: enyc: ok
[23:47:43] enyc: trouble with that packaging approach is — just because the build-dep might get a certain php version installed, doesn't mean its the veriso the user will use
[23:48:16] enyc: you'd eralyl want builds of binaries that work regardless of php5 or php7 being that which gets used, surely ?
[23:48:29] enyc: rather than trying to determine at build-time
[23:48:48] enyc: i can ask wookey for advice on the best-practice approach
[23:49:30] tgm4883: enyc: that detection was added so we know where to drop the mythweb file
[23:49:39] tgm4883: if there's a better solution, I'd like to hear it
[23:49:49] enyc: tgm4883: right, but it seems to be at the wrong time (build time, not install or run time)
[23:49:52] tgm4883: it's all coming back to me now what that was added
[23:50:39] tgm4883: enyc: IIRC, doing it at install time means moving that from debconf to a postinst cp command
[23:50:42] tgm4883: which is less than ideal
[23:50:42] enyc: certainly the current build-dep is wrong, if it has to work that way, it should be changed to php-dev|php7-dev or whatever it was exactly
[23:50:58] enyc: so it doesn't try to install web servers in build chroots
[23:51:56] tgm4883: enyc: I don't see a php-dev for 14.04
[23:53:01] tgm4883: php5-dev
[23:53:20] enyc: silly question but whats' wrong with just always including both variants of the config file (always installing php and php7 config directories)
[23:53:52] enyc: debian stretch, for example has *both* php versions as an option
[23:54:05] tgm4883: enyc: there isn't 2 versions of the config file, there is only 1, but they go in a different location in php7
[23:54:23] enyc: tgm4883: right, i mean... whats wrong with just installing it in both places always ?
[23:54:34] enyc: tgm4883: one will of course get ignored and not matter
[23:54:47] tgm4883: enyc: because it fails if the directory structure doesn't exist?
[23:55:09] enyc: tgm4883: i (thought) dpkg coped with that, if its in the source it just makes directory
[23:55:20] tgm4883: hmm
[23:55:29] enyc: tgm4883: hrrm i search package archives for other packages installing sucrh php configs
[23:55:47] tgm4883: superm1: ^
[23:56:33] superm1: Well that's a good option
[23:56:38] superm1: Just install in both
[23:56:48] superm1: We can make the package structure part of our deb
[23:57:09] enyc: that would rather simplify this a lot ;p
[23:57:26] tgm4883: that works for me, so we'll drop all php build deps then?
[23:57:28] enyc: and get rid of the silly build-dep and all
[23:57:49] enyc: but need to check that works correctly of course
[23:58:06] superm1: Yeah that works for me
